In this study, the effect of adding carbon nanotubes on quasi-static penetration punch shear in glass/epoxy composite laminates is experimentally studied. The nanocomposites have 12 layers of 2D woven glass fiber produced by hand lay-up method. Also in the study of multi-walled carbon nanotubes (MWCNTs) modified with hydroxide (- COOH) with 0, 0.1, 0.5 and 1 weights percentage (relative to the total weight of matrix) were used. Punch shear test results indicate that adding carbon nanotubes not only improve the maximum contact force, but also may reduce the maximum contact force in speciofic weight percentages. The largest increases in the total amount of energy absorbed is 4% in 1 wt%.
